TeamViewer ne capture pas Alt + Tab dans Linux Mint (Mate)

11

Lorsque j'exécute Teamviewer sur Windows, lorsque j'appuie sur Alt + Tab, TeamViewer l'attrape et l'envoie au système d'exploitation distant, qui change ensuite de fenêtre.

Mais lorsque j'exécute Teamviewer sur Linux Mint (Mate) et que j'appuie sur Alt + Tab, je passe simplement de Teamviewer à une autre fenêtre sur mon ordinateur hôte.

Existe-t-il un moyen pour que Teamviewer intercepte la combinaison de touches Alt + Tab? Peut-être que le gestionnaire de fenêtres (marco dans ce cas) peut ne pas traiter Alt + Tab si la fenêtre actuelle est Teamviewer?

sashoalm
la source

Réponses:

18

J'ai trouvé une solution par hasard (mais je suis depuis passé à Lubuntu):

Alt + WinKey + Tab fonctionne! C'est un raccourci un peu lourd, mais c'est mieux que rien. Mais je ne l'ai testé que sur Lubuntu (qui utilise Openbox comme gestionnaire de fenêtres). Pourtant, je pense que cela devrait aussi fonctionner sur MATE.

sashoalm
la source
1
Confirmation du travail sur l'équipe Xubuntu 15.10 visualisée dans Windows 7.
kevinf
Arrêt de travailler avec TeamViewer version 13.2 sur Ubuntu
kasi
fonctionne avec TeamViewer 15.3
user1810087
2

De la page Github de marco :

 - Les valeurs par défaut des raccourcis clavier globaux incluent:

    Focus sur la fenêtre du cycle avant Alt-Tab
    Alt-Shift-Tab focus cycle arrière
    Alt-Ctrl-Tab focus du cycle avant parmi les panneaux
    Alt-Ctrl-Shift-Tab focus cycle arrière parmi les panneaux
    Focus sur la fenêtre du cycle Alt-Escape sans un popup
    Espace de travail précédent Ctrl-Alt-Flèche gauche
    Espace de travail suivant Ctrl-Alt-Flèche droite
    Ctrl-Alt-D minimiser / minimiser tout, pour afficher le bureau

   Modifiez les raccourcis clavier par exemple:

     gsettings set org.mate.Marco.global-keybindings switch_to_workspace_1 'F1'

   Essayez également le panneau de configuration des raccourcis clavier MATE.

   Voir marco.schemas pour toutes les fixations disponibles.

Vous pouvez donc soit utiliser gsettingspour modifier le raccourci pour cycle_windowsou utiliser dconf-editorpour faire la même chose à l'aide d'une interface graphique. Pour utiliser dconf-editor, exécutez:

sudo apt-get install dconf-tools

Les raccourcis clavier que vous devrez modifier doivent se trouver sous:

org → compagnon → Marco → raccourcis clavier
Vinayak
la source
1
Cela ressemble à changer Alt + Tab pour toutes les fenêtres, ce qui n'est pas ce dont j'ai besoin. Je dois le désactiver pour la fenêtre de connexion Teamviewer, mais le garder activé pour toutes les autres fenêtres.
sashoalm
@sashoalm Je n'ai aucun moyen de tester cela pour le moment, mais AutoKey aide-t-il? Vous pouvez créer une «phrase» qui est envoyée <alt>+<tab>au filtre de la fenêtre TeamViewer.exe.Winelorsque vous appuyez sur un raccourci personnalisé (par exemple, Maj + Alt + S ).
Vinayak